Rocket Threats and Split Wins
Aviamasters introduces rockets that pop up unpredictably during flight:
- Rocket appearance – Every few seconds there may be one or more rockets on the path.
- Effect – Each rocket halves your entire collected amount at that moment.
- Frequency – The game balances them so they appear often enough to add tension but rarely enough to ruin every round.
This mechanic forces players to weigh the extra risk of higher multipliers against the danger of losing half what they’ve already earned.
A short‑session player typically watches for rockets only as they pop up—there’s no time to strategize beyond picking a speed.
All‑or‑Nothing Landing – The Moment of Truth
The climax arrives when your plane approaches a small boat on the sea:
- If it lands on the deck—you win everything accumulated in that round.
- If it misses—you lose your bet entirely.
The landing is entirely random; no player input can influence it after launch. This randomness preserves the tension that makes each round feel like a micro‑tournament.
